Correlates of shoulder pain in wheelchair basketball players from the Japanese national team: A cross-sectional study

Abstract: Because top male wheelchair basketball players have a higher risk of shoulder pain than female players, daily care of shoulder and periodic medical checkups are needed, especially for older male players with lower ability and more experience.
